Pre-School Year
Pre-School runs from September to June and during that time follows the regular school calendar with the exception of Professional Development days.
3 Year Old Class
An introduction to skill building in the areas of social, physical, intellectual, creative & emotional development with an emphasis on social & emotional skills. Classes run for 2 hours once/week. A choice of 4 class times are available. The child must be 3 years old by December 31st.
4 Year Old Class
Offering more challenging opportunities and experiences to further enhance the above skills. Classes run for 2 1/2 hours twice/week. A choice of 3 class times are available. The child must be 4 years old by December 31st.
Why Is Pre-School Important?
The early years are the most important when it comes to ensuring that a child is ready for school. Our emphasis is on socialization, behavioural skills and kindergarten readiness by learning through play. All activities incorporate alphabet and number skills.
How are Parents Involved?
Parent involvement is key to the success of this program.
- Bring juice on designated days (2-3 times per year).
- Volunteer for special events.
- Share a story, song or talent if desired.
- Help to chaperone a field trip.
- Opportunity to be on Parent Board of Directors.
- A volunteer parent is present at each class, along with 2 staff.
- Assist with fundraising.
Typical Day
This is a short list of some of the things we offer:
- Roll call
- Show and tell
- Letter & number of the day
- Discussion of theme of the month
- Art or craft activities
- Gym or outdoor activities
- Interactive reading
- Singing
Mission Statement
Pre-School provides a nurturing and stimulating atmosphere to promote the use of a child’s most important learning tool - that of meaningful play.
It is our belief that through such play, the child will gain increased self esteem, as well as healthy growth in the areas of social, physical, intellectual, creative, emotional and sensory development.
Through our program we strive for a warm and caring environment for 3 and 4 year olds to build self-confidence, make friends, as well as interact and socialize with children their own age in a group setting.
